Brazilian President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va criticized the newly proposed 25 percent US tariffs on certain Brazilian imports, saying he could 'not accept the treatment' his country received. The move by the Trump administration contradicted Lula's optimism after a May meeting at the White House. Tensions have been high between the two leaders over trade, human rights, and politics, with previous tariffs reaching 50 percent after former President Jair Bolsonaro's conviction. Lula stated that Brazil still wants institutional relations with the US but may seek other trade partners if necessary.
